post release stuff
git-svn-id: https://pmd.svn.sourceforge.net/svnroot/pmd/trunk@1989 51baf565-9d33-0410-a72c-fc3788e3496d
This commit is contained in:
@ -57,6 +57,10 @@
|
|||||||
<jar jarfile="${lib}\pmd-${version}.jar" basedir="${build}" manifest="etc/MANIFEST.MF"/>
|
<jar jarfile="${lib}\pmd-${version}.jar" basedir="${build}" manifest="etc/MANIFEST.MF"/>
|
||||||
</target>
|
</target>
|
||||||
|
|
||||||
|
<target name="jarsrc" depends="copy,compile">
|
||||||
|
<jar jarfile="${lib}\pmd-src-${version}.jar" basedir="${src}"/>
|
||||||
|
</target>
|
||||||
|
|
||||||
<target name="pmd">
|
<target name="pmd">
|
||||||
<taskdef name="pmd" classname="net.sourceforge.pmd.ant.PMDTask"/>
|
<taskdef name="pmd" classname="net.sourceforge.pmd.ant.PMDTask"/>
|
||||||
<pmd rulesetfiles="rulesets/imports.xml">
|
<pmd rulesetfiles="rulesets/imports.xml">
|
||||||
|
@ -32,13 +32,17 @@ cd -
|
|||||||
|
|
||||||
Time to tag:
|
Time to tag:
|
||||||
|
|
||||||
|
cd ../../
|
||||||
cvs -q rtag -D tomorrow "pmd_release_1_1" pmd
|
cvs -q rtag -D tomorrow "pmd_release_1_1" pmd
|
||||||
|
|
||||||
Prepare source release:
|
Prepare source release:
|
||||||
rm -rf ~/tmp/pmd-1.1
|
rm -rf ~/tmp/pmd-1.1
|
||||||
mkdir tmp
|
mkdir tmp
|
||||||
cvs -q export -d /home/tom/tmp/pmd-1.1 -r pmd_release_1_1 pmd
|
cvs -q export -d tmp/ -r pmd_release_1_1 pmd
|
||||||
<<<<Run a new Ant target that creates a src jar>>>
|
cd pmd/etc
|
||||||
|
ant jarsrc
|
||||||
|
cd ../../
|
||||||
|
cp pmd/lib/pmd-src-1.1.jar tmp/lib/
|
||||||
mv tmp ~/tmp/pmd-1.1
|
mv tmp ~/tmp/pmd-1.1
|
||||||
cp pmd/lib/pmd-1.1.jar ~/tmp/pmd-1.1/lib
|
cp pmd/lib/pmd-1.1.jar ~/tmp/pmd-1.1/lib
|
||||||
cp -R pmd/target/docs ~/tmp/pmd-1.1/
|
cp -R pmd/target/docs ~/tmp/pmd-1.1/
|
||||||
|
Reference in New Issue
Block a user